I revealed the primary attributes of the EWA units on Wednesday. Today, I’m going to talk about their secondary attributes.

Now that I have the spreadsheet in front of me, I see that I forgot a couple primary attributes: Area and Fatigue. Area is the area of effect a unit’s attack has. Fatigue is the number of rounds a unit must “rest” after attacking before it can be activated again.

The secondary attributes include race, level, cost and size. EWA units are either Medium or Large. Medium units occupy a single square, while Large units occupy four squares (2×2) and count as two units. A unit’s level governs its attribute bonuses and cost. Players cannot command units whose level is greater than the player’s Warlord level.

A unit’s cost is the amount of gold a player must spend to hire the unit from the Guild. It is also the point cost of using the unit on your team.

Finally, each unit has a race. Every race has a racial enemy. A unit will not join a team that has a unit from its racial enemy. EWA will release with four races: Dwarf, Elf, Human and Orc. Elves and Orcs are racial enemies.
